Is there a simple way to connect to asterisk/allstar via a udp socket ? I
have a source of network audio that can source and receive raw PCM, 64K, 8
bit. I've looked at the rtpdir and  outbound-only RTSP drivers but can't
quite figure out how they really work, at least not quickly,  and I was
hoping someone already has this .. it needs to support COS and PTT
signaling as well of course ..
